Until the current write-a-thon ends I have only small chunks of time, far apart, in which to read for pleasure. It&#8217;s a time for short stories.<br \/>\nSo I turned to a purchase I had made some while back but not yet cracked&#8211;the first three of Night Shade Books&#8217; handsome new five-volume set of the collected fantasies of Clark Ashton Smith. It&#8217;s been many years since I&#8217;ve read more of Smith than the oft-anthologized greatest hits: &#8220;The Return of the Sorceror,&#8221; say, or &#8220;A Rendezvous in Averoigne.&#8221; I&#8217;m enjoying the strangeness.<\/p>\n<p>Stap my vitals, but that man could sling a thesaurus. He makes HPL look like Hemingway. I rarely have to resort to a dictionary while reading for pleasure, but by a third of the way through the first volume I had had to look up the following words:<\/p>\n<p>nacarat<br \/>\ninvultuations<br \/>\ninenarrable<br \/>\nfescennine<br \/>\nparapegm<\/p>\n<p>A profound obeisance and a complimentary OED to anyone who knows the meanings of all five without looking them up. (Just kidding about the OED, unfortunately.)<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Missed deadlines are piling up around me like the leaves of Vallambrosa, only less picturesquely, and I&#8217;m scrambling to catch up with my writing and fend off the wrath of my publisher.
